Ariecchime!!!

Che figata... sta prendendo forma il mio primo sito in PHP, multilingua, form contatti, a elementi separati (headre, footer, ..).

Proprio per il form mail però mi sorge un problemo! (maschile!)

Se nel form mail metto come destinatario un indirizzo tipo Gmail funzia l'html (quindi anche le immagini etc..), se però il form mail lo faccio inviare a Libero, l'html lo legge così come si scrive...

Sapete dirmi come fa ad esempio la Apple, o l'Euronics, ad inviare mail in html leggibili anche da caselle di posta scrause come quella di Libero?

Vi posto il codice per scrupolo:

Codice PHP:
<?php
    $linkimmagine 
"http://www.miosito.it/images/logouc.jpg";
    
    
$intestazioni  "MIME-Version: 1.0\r\n";
    
$intestazioni .= "Content-type: text/html; charset=UTF-8\r\n";
    
//intestazioni per il mittente
    
$intestazioni .= "From: Miosito<info@miosito.it>\r\n";
    
$messaggio="<html><head><title></title></head><body>";
    
$messaggio.="<img src=\"$linkimmagine\" />

"
;
    
$messaggio.="<div>Questa email ti è stata inviata dal sito.
 L'utente 
$_POST[nome] (a cui puoi rispondere a: <a href=\"mailto:$_POST[indirizzo]\">$_POST[indirizzo]</a>,

Ti ha scritto: 
$_POST[testo]</div>";
    
$messaggio.="</body></html>";
    
mail("miamail@libero.it""Invio email da: $_POST[nome]"$messaggio,$intestazioni);
?>
Grazio (sempre maschile)